Getting Divorced in Nevada

According to Nevada Code, divorce may be obtained for any of the following causes:

  • Insanity existing for 2 years prior to the commencement of the action.
  • When the husband and wife have lived separate and apart for 1 year without cohabitation.
  • Incompatibility.

Residency Requirements

The plaintiff or defendant must have been a resident of Nevada for a period of not less than 6 weeks preceding the commencement of the action.

Waiting Period

There is no waiting period in Nevada.
